UK - Oak Hill to acquire United Utilities' outsourcing business

A private equity consortium headed up by Oak Hill, the US group, is to acquire the United Utilities' business outsourcing division, Vertex. The £220m deal follows United Utilities decision to sell Vertex due to falling profits within the division.

UK - Sovereign completes two recapitalisations

Sovereign Capital has announced a £37m recapitalisation of TRACSCARE Limited and a £16m recapitalisation of Truecare Holdings Limited. Both companies focus on providing specialist care to adults with learning difficulties and mental health needs in...
